Who are we?
Founded in 1993 and based in Franche-Comté, ITB INNOVATION puts its sense of innovation and the excellence of its achievements at the service of its customers to develop customised clamping solutions for machining
ITB’s clamping systems are built to hold workpieces securely and consistently while minimising the risk of deformation. Compactness is a characteristic of ITB’s products, allowing machining processes to be optimised efficiently.
According to Christophe Boiteux, the company’s founding CEO, in recent years the mass introduction of robots in machine shops and the industrial revolution 4.0 have been a formidable vector for the company’s development. Automating workpiece loading necessarily means automating positioning and clamping, as well as optimising changeover solutions.
To support this industrial revolution, ITB Innovation is constantly developing its expertise by offering fully integrated solutions, from hydraulic power units to clamping systems, including the automation of clamping cycles and the integration of complex feed systems.
From the preliminary design to the 3D study, from machining to assembly and inspection of its products, ITB Innovation controls every stage of the manufacturing process for its clamping systems and guarantees an extreme degree of quality, repeatability, and reliability. ITB INNOVATION systems are durable and used in over 20 countries.

Our history
The ITB adventure began in 1993 when Christophe Boiteux invented and marketed a patented system: the Magic System.
This system, still available today, allows wooden parts to be machined on CNC centres. From its inception, this efficient and economical system achieved strong sales and was successfully exported across Europe.
Over the next three years, ITB developed other innovative systems in parallel, including:
- The left and right rotation machining tool.
- The suction cup table system.
From 1996, ITB equipped its design office with a high-performance 3D CAD system: SOLIDWORKS.
ITB leveraged its innovative capabilities to enter the industrial tooling market, focusing on hydraulic clamping systems. This became its core business and spurred significant growth. To maintain a competitive edge, ITB developed unique hydraulic clamping solutions for integration with machining tools.
The development of compact systems is important for this type of product, allowing for optimised and higher-performance solutions compared to using standard components. In recent years, the increasing use of robots in machine shops and advancements related to Industry 4.0 have also contributed to the company's growth.
Since January 2004, ITB Innovation has been based in the Autechaux industrial estate, 5 km from Baume-les-Dames and close to the motorway (A36 Baume-les-Dames exit).
Franche-Comté's location allows easy access to Germany, Switzerland, Italy, and facilitates international collaboration.
Since 2009, ITB Innovation has acquired various types of machinery to bring its machining operations in-house. The equipment currently consists of over 30 CNC machines, such as 5-axis machining centres, 4- and 5-axis turning centres, wire EDM machines, conventional, NC, and robotic grinding machines, a drilling machine, and two three-dimensional inspection machines. The adjustment and assembly area of the workshop is responsible for the precision and quality control of the finished products.
ITB produces all components internally. To date, the only process that has been outsourced is heat treatment.
The company has used a CAM system since 2010, with TOPSOLID software bridging CAD and machines. This enables fast machining of complex parts and reduces human error.
Currently, the company employs 50 individuals who are involved in designing and manufacturing machining fixtures, special chucks, and hydraulic feed systems. The team works with modern resources, supporting ITB Innovation's annual growth. The company's consistent growth in turnover allows for ongoing investment aligned with market needs. Our advantage
Our workshop features advanced CNC machining equipment that is regularly upgraded for optimal precision and productivity. Ongoing investment ensures we deliver responsive service and top-quality results through complete process control.
Our production fleet consists of
A fleet of 20 machining and turning centres, including a drilling centre.
A fleet of 13 grinding machines, including one robotic machine, and 5 wire-cut machines.
An assembly and testing workshop
A metrology room equipped with two coordinate measuring machines
